HC Deb 09 January 1985 vol 70 c478W
Mr. Mikardo

asked the Secretary of State for the Environment if he will give a breakdown of how many of the jobs in the enterprise zone in the Isle of Dogs have been transferred from other locations; and how many of the jobs in the enterprise zone have been newly created.

Sir George Young

The consultants who monitored economic activity in the zones reported that up to 31 May 1983 a net total of 77 firms had been established in the Isle of Dogs enterprise zone, employing 353 people. Of these, 186 were in jobs in new firms and 124 were in firms relocated from elsewhere; the origins of 20 firms, comprising 43 jobs were unknown.

The consultants also estimated that in the period 1 June to 31 December 1983 a further 451 jobs were established in the zone but I do not have any information as to what proportion of these jobs were in new firms.
